Supposed £7,300 paye underpayment 08/09 and 09/10

Hi Everyone,

I rang HMRC yesterday to sort oun an error on my tax code for 2011/12 and was informed i had a letter on its way out informing me of an £7,300 tax underpayment, £6,500 was for 08/09 and £800 from 09/10.

To say i feel physically sick is an understatement. This has arisen due to having a company car up to 01/04/2010. I have no issue paying the last years amount as i can see where the error has occurred and they are notifying me within the allocated 12 months however the 08/09 bill is ridiculous.during that period i had 4 different company cars (due to one being stolen mid year and then being given pool cars that were always near end of lease and then having to go back to lease company).

The really frustrating thing is that they were notified of all changes and my tax code was changed twice in the year.

I really dont know where to go from here as i am worried that my next two years are going to be hell because of this.

I have read about people challenging the letters due to the HMRC not acting within appropriate timescales etc, would this be applicable to me?

Any help would be greatly appreciated

    First you need to check that HMRCs calculations are accurate.

    If they have been adjusting your tax code because of the company car changes, there is a good chance that they have miscalculated.

    You need to check your P11Ds and P60s for the two tax years against your P2 Coding Notices and the P800 letter(s) when it arrives.

    Post the figures on here if you need help with the checks.

  • my P2 for tax year 09/10 (dated 11,01,2009 so based on previous 08/09 figures) states:
    your tax code is K494
    Here is how it is worked out:
    your personal allowance is £6475
    Car benefit is -£9542
    reduction to collect unpaid tax £753.46 is -£1883 Total -£11425
    tax is due on -£4950

    This is just a holy mess, i have been on a K tax code for 3 years as it always seems to be wrong.

    I'm so fed up with this and that why i opted out of the company car scheme, help!

    You definately need to collect together as much documentation as you can going back through several tax years until you can be sure that you can check all the calculations.

    Your P60s will tell you your total earnings, tax paid and final tax code for each tax year. Check the tax code against the relevant P2 to make sure the appropriate code has been used.
    Check that the tax code on the P2 was calculated correctly.
    Then check that the tax owed for previous years is accurate as shown on the 09/10 P2 - i.e. "reduction to collect unpaid tax £753.46"

    Does the figure of "Car benefit is -£9542" agree with your P11D ?

    It's a case of steadily working through the documentation you have for each tax year to confirm that HMRC have used the appropriate values in their calculation.

    The P11D you received on 15 Jun 2009 would have been for the 2008-09 tax year.
    The P2 received in Jan 2009 would be for the 2009-10 tax year, so the answer to your question about the P2 is : Yes, it is a forecast based on what happened in the previous tax year.

    The tax paid from the 08/09 P60 looks OK based on the tax code of K285, so the only question is if that was the appropriate tax code for your circumstances ?

    It will help us to see the full picture if you pull all the paperwork together for tax years 07/08, 08/09 and 09/10 then post all the figures in one go.
